Which entity is responsible for monitoring all licensing examinations?

The Department of Health is responsible for monitoring all licensing examinations. This role is critical as the Department oversees various aspects of public health and the licensing processes for healthcare professionals in Florida, ensuring that standards are met for the safety and qualification of practitioners. By monitoring licensing examinations, the Department helps to maintain professional standards within nursing and other healthcare fields, promoting public safety and trust in the healthcare system.

The other entities mentioned, while they have important roles in healthcare, do not specifically oversee the licensing examinations. The Board of Medicine primarily focuses on the regulation of medical practices and professionals. The Florida Center of Nursing focuses on workforce issues and nursing education rather than directly monitoring licensing exams. The Florida Senate is involved in legislative processes and does not play a direct role in the oversight of licensing examinations.
